It's nice to see people pimp a companies product and all, but 600 bucks for a PI intake swap Compared to the way I did it for under $170, no comparison.

For 600 bucks you might as well do a headswap.[/QUOTE]

Like I stated earlier I plan to put a blower on it in a couple of months. I did not want the compression or the issue with RTV with a blown application. I rather bite the bullit and just pay the extra money for reliability.

TopDeadCenter said:
Hey KBOY..i know you have PI intake and Cams..are your heads stock? Cause the NPI heads really arnt that bad...one..and 2..leave em that way theres not such a problem with charging, etc.. doto compression...what kind of gains did you gain with pi cams and intake?
Click to expand...

I still do have the stock heads but with Comp Cams. The heads aren't really that bad at all. By putting on the intake and cams it is a whole other car after 3000 rpm. By me doing this I will be able to run a blower in the future without the worries of compression from a headswap. Like what Coramprat said I also will be going to T&J in a couple of weeks for a tune and to see what type of gains I have compared to the headswap.
